This additional latency is enough to significantly limit the peak bandwidth that can be supported by USB bridging even on a LAN. USB bridging places that webcam on a lower bandwidth network connection that is now milliseconds away from the CPU. This is fine when they are plugged into a physical PC with a high-speed USB bus that is only microseconds away from the CPU. Webcams (especially now that they are HD) require a large amount of bandwidth to transfer the uncompressed pixels from the camera. * Please download the latest version of Skype, Skype 5.8 for Windows, which offers 1080p HD video calling.RT-AV was created to overcome the bandwidth limitations of USB bridging. This means that on my Mac, Handbrake is now transcoding DVDs in real time or faster thanks to the improvements in the new version. In 0.9.4, using the same settings, I'm seeing encoding rates of closer to 30 - 34 frames per second. Using 0.9.3, Handbrake encodes would average around 27 - 29 frames per second when transcoding a VIDEO_TS folder to H.264. That 10% performance improvement estimate appears to be very close to the mark, at least on my MacBook Pro. The 64-bit build is not exclusive to Snow Leopard, so if you're still running 10.5 on a 64-bit capable machine, you'll still be able to reap the benefits of reduced encoding time. The biggest new feature with this update is support for 64-bit, which allows Handbrake to encode approximately 10% faster than previous 32-bit builds. The Handbrake team has been busy indeed over the past year - their change log shows over 1000 changes since the build they released last year. The Professional Edition of HDClone is conceived for daily use. HDClone Standard Edition supports besides IDE/ATA and SATA/eSATA hard disks and USB Mass Storage devices (hard disk, stick, card reader) via USB 1.1 also the far more swift USB 2.0 standard and copies up to 1,2 GB/min. Besides support for USB 2.0 and IDE-CompactFlash, it also offers a verifying mode for data reconciliation with the target medium and high copying performance. The Standard Edition of HDClone is conceived for regular and professional use. HDClone Basic Edition supports besides IDE/ATA and SATA/eSATA hard disks also USB Mass Storage devices (hard disk, stick, card reader) via USB 1.1 and copies up to 600 MB/min. Furthermore, it contains extended options for backup ('Disk-to-Partition-Backup'), system restore (partition copy), and data rescue ('SafeRescue' mode). Besides USB support and higher performance, it also offers arbitrary copy directions (not only small»large like the Free Edition). The Basic Edition of HDClone is conceived for occasional utilisation, especially for migrating complete installations, backups, data rescue, and system restore. HDClone Free Edition supports IDE/ATA and SATA/eSATA hard disks and is able to copy up to 300 MB/min. But in case of more frequent usage, we recommend using one of the higher editions since they offer higher performance in the first line but also support a wider range of hardware as well as additional options which are optimized for regular or professional usage. The Free Edition is real freeware without obligation to buy and is intended for the short-term usage at no cost. This can be utilized to migrate an existing installation to a new hard disk as well as for data rescue. The Free Edition of HDClone offers all necessary abilities to copy a complete hard disk onto another, larger hard disk. Depending on the sizes of the hard disks, a complete or abridged image of the source disk will be created. HDClone copies the content of hard disks on a physical level from one disk to another hard disk. Since the play is wordless and largely without text (species are labelled with their Latin and common names at some points), the sound effects help to clarify what is happening and the materials in use, such as running water or electricity. Each station has machines to turn on, knobs to crank, faucets to open, or buttons to push. The lab itself is visually interesting and begs to be explored. They even giggle and shake their leaves in response to touch. They respond with joy and exuberance to stimuli they like and with fear and shudders at stimuli they dislike. The plants, as characters in this app, are endearing. In playing with these lab tools, the player can propagate plants, discover new plants, nurture others in pots, and keep track of them all in a botany chart. Five lab stations offer chances to experiment: a grow light, watering tank, nutrition station, cloning machine, and crossbreeding apparatus. Upon opening the app, players enter a lab where a plant bobs happily in in the center, waiting to be played with the plants are quite friendly and invite the player to interact. Toca Lab: Plants provides an open and unstructured environment to both nurture and experiment with plants.
